介绍
Velocity.js是一款jquery动画引擎插件,它拥有与jquery中的$.animate()相同的API,还打包了颜色动画,转换,循环,easing效果,类动画、滚动等功能,因此大家可以像使用$.animate()方法一样使用velocity,您可以快速的上手velocity.js。简单点说:Velocity就是实现页面元素中的飞入,飞出,旋转、颜色变换,esaing效果的jquery动画插件
jquery实例:Velocity动画插件的使用方法
引入核心文件
|
|
写入html
|
|
写入CSS,此处的CSS可根椐自己的需求定义,还有不了解CSS3的朋友,请先学习下CSS3,在这就不一一的解释了
|
|
写入JS,实现效果
|
|
参数
velocity可以传两个参数,第一个可以像css参数一样传输属性和值,而对象的选项则可以通过第二个参数传递,代码如下:
|
|
单一对象
Velocity支持单一个参数模式
|
|
逗号分隔
代替对象选项的参数输入,还可以使用像jquery中的逗号分隔模式,但仅限于duration, easing, andcomplete属性;代码如下
|
|